Output 61f68f0ee43987de26f9bf6603d80e1983529f924d3c399c5e56e551c8331fba:0
- value
- 25277218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3dceb94d07b4e37524bcdbdcf7483164ba43999 OP_EQUAL
- address
- 3M1F9pwL3bgqg8VRsrckHKa9VaS7yufprM
- transaction
- 61f68f0ee43987de26f9bf6603d80e1983529f924d3c399c5e56e551c8331fba
- confirmations
- 404800
- spent
- true